🔑 Car Key & Fob FAQ

Common questions about key programming, fob issues, and replacement options

Key Fob Issues
This typically indicates: weak fob battery (replace first), damaged fob antenna, or issues with your car's receiver (often in the door handle or rearview mirror). Environmental interference from other electronics can also reduce range.
Key Programming
Some vehicles allow DIY key programming using specific sequences (like turning ignition on/off with original keys). However, most modern cars require specialized equipment only locksmiths or dealers have. Check your owner's manual for your specific model.

Key Programming
Common reasons: wrong key type for your vehicle, anti-theft system needs reset, low car battery voltage during programming, or the key isn't properly synced. Some cars also have programming limits (only 2-4 keys can be registered).
Lost Keys
Yes, a skilled auto locksmith can extract the broken key and make a replacement. They can often do this without damaging the ignition cylinder. The new key will need programming if it has a transponder chip.
Lost Keys
1) Contact a locksmith who specializes in automotive keys or your dealership 2) Provide proof of ownership (registration, title, ID) 3) They'll either cut new keys by code or reprogram your car's system 4) This is expensive ($200-$800) as the immobilizer may need resetting.
Key Fact: Modern transponder keys have been required in all new US vehicles since 1998
